Thessalian cavalryman on horse prancing left, wearing chlamys and petasos and carrying a short sword in a scabbard held by a baldric. He is holding the reins with his left hand and a spear pointing forward and down with his right hand. In field below IA in tiny letters; above right, a small A; border of dots |

| Reversbeschreibung |
Warrior in fighting attitude advancing left, wearing petasos, short tunic and carrying on his waist a sword, a spear in his raised right hand and a shield with two more spears in his left hand. |
